Definition

Composer; a musician who specializes in writing musical pieces.

neutralpeople

How it's used

Refers specifically to someone who writes music, often used in the context of classical music or professional songwriting. While it is a formal title, it is frequently used in casual conversation when discussing music history or pop industry credits. It is common to see this paired with the name of a specific genre to clarify the type of music they create.

Common mistake

Avoid confusing this with 填詞人, which refers specifically to a lyricist. In the Hong Kong music industry, these two roles are often distinct, so using the wrong term can be factually incorrect when discussing song credits.
